ZURICH, ZURICH, SWITZERLAND, July 14, 2025 /EINPresswire.com/ -- The European Union’s new NIS2 Directive (Network and Information Security Directive 2) marks a significant regulatory turning point for cybersecurity. With broader applicability and stricter requirements than its predecessor, NIS2 obliges companies across multiple sectors to rethink their governance, risk, and compliance (GRC) infrastructure—immediately.

The NIS2 Shift: From IT Problem to Boardroom PriorityNIS2, which came into force in January 2023 and must be implemented by member states by October 2024, expands its scope beyond critical infrastructure. It now applies to a wide range of medium and large enterprises in sectors such as:
- Energy, transport, healthcare, water
- Digital infrastructure and IT services
- Public administration, research, and space

The directive mandates:
Structured risk management for cyber and information security
Incident reporting within 24 hours
A company-wide cybersecurity strategy
Board-level accountability
Audits and documentation obligations
Failure to comply can result in severe penalties, reputational damage, and personal liability for executives.

Key Steps for Companies Now
Assess NIS2 applicability: Are you covered under the directive?
Perform a gap analysis: Identify compliance and security weaknesses.
Define clear responsibilities: Ensure leadership is informed and involved.
Upgrade GRC systems: Can your system handle real-time compliance demands?
Raise awareness: Train teams and align your organization with the new standard.
